About the Role

First Eagle Investments is an independent, privately owned investment management firm headquartered in New York with approximately $152 billion in assets under management as of March 31, 2025. With a heritage dating back to 1864, First Eagle Investments has served as a prudent steward of client capital across market cycles, varying macroeconomic conditions and numerous disruptive events. The firm applies disciplined, unconventional thinking across a range of investment capabilities, including equities, fixed income, currencies, alternative credit, and real assets, with a shared emphasis on mitigating downside risk. Key Responsibilities

  • Lead the end-to-end digital analytics strategy across website, email, social media, SEO/SEM, display, paid media and other digital campaigns.
  • Partner with IT/vendors to consolidate all proprietary and third-party data into a centralized database/CDP.
  • Design, build, and maintain comprehensive dashboards and performance reports using Tableau, GA4, Google Looker Studio, and other reporting tools.
  • Establish key performance indicators (KPIs), trends, and benchmarks to assess digital performance, campaign efficacy, and customer engagement.
  • Deliver clear, concise insights and recommendations to senior leadership and marketing stakeholders to inform content, campaign, and channel strategies.
  • Partner with web development and marketing technology teams to ensure accurate and scalable tagging and tracking (Google Analytics 4, Google Tag Manager, UTM governance, etc.).
  • Partner with the Client Experience Director to develop A/B testing and experimentation strategies to optimize user engagement, conversion, and ROI.
  • Provide quarterly and annual digital performance reviews to inform broader business strategy.
  • Ensure compliance with data governance and privacy standards within financial services.
